This book is another fine addition to the Busy Town Series. My 5 year old and I have been hooked on these books since he was about 2 and his brothers before him, the same. Only the 5 year old adores them so much, we have ordered most of them. Busy Town books are always upbeat, positive and sweet. Mr Fixit is often the hero of the stories, making everything all better, and this book showcases his talents in particular.This one teaches you about magnets and the 5 year old, who is learning to read, is able to pick out words and read some of it himself (with my help). Because we travel much of the time, it is so nice these books are paperback and light to pack. We take a bunch with us wherever we go. Every visit with Mr Fixit, Huckle, Lowly and the other residents of Busy Town is a joy, and I'm so glad we got this one to add to the collection! |
